Asian stocks today: Markets fall as oil tops $112, inflation concerns weigh; Wall Street extends losses

Equity markets across Asia declined on Thursday, tracking losses on Wall Street after a sharp rise in oil prices above $112 per barrel and renewed concerns over inflation and interest rates dampened investor sentiment. In early trading Tokyo’s Nikkei 225 dropped 2.5% to 53,875.94, while South Korea’s Kospi fell 1.3% to 5,845.62. Hong Kong’s Hang…

FOMC policy meeting: Jerome Powell-led US Federal Reserve keeps interest rates unchanged; flags ‘uncertainty’ related to impact of Iran war

Jerome Powell (AP file photo) US Federal Reserve policy: Jerome Powell-led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) on Wednesday kept interest rates unchanged within the 3.50%-3.75% band. “In support of its goals, the Committee decided to maintain the target range for the federal funds rate at 3‑1/2 to 3‑3/4 percent. In considering the extent and timing…
